Multi-grid parallel ptychographic algorithm for frequency-resolved optical gating.

Fucai Ding, Ping Zhu, Rana Jafari

    Optics Express
    |August 13, 2025
    PubMed
    Summary
    This summary is machine-generated.

    This study introduces a new pulse reconstruction method for frequency-resolved optical gating (FROG) that overcomes limitations of traditional algorithms. The enhanced approach ensures stable convergence for accurate pulse retrieval, even with noisy or incomplete data.

    Area of Science:

    • Optics and Photonics
    • Ultrafast Laser Science
    • Computational Imaging

    Background:

    • Ptychographic reconstruction is vital for pulse phase retrieval, offering super-resolution and robustness with incomplete data.
    • A key challenge is convergence stagnation caused by local minima in gradient descent strategies.
    • Existing methods struggle with complex pulse shapes, high noise, and incomplete traces.

    Purpose of the Study:

    • To develop a novel pulse reconstruction approach for frequency-resolved optical gating (FROG).
    • To overcome the limitations of local minima and convergence stagnation in ptychographic algorithms.
    • To achieve robust and accurate pulse retrieval, especially for complex laser pulses.

    Main Methods:

    • Implementation of a multi-grid flexible sampling strategy.
    • Utilization of a parallel extended ptychographic iterative engine (ePIE).
    • Numerical and experimental validation of the proposed reconstruction approach.

    Main Results:

    • The new method effectively escapes local minima, demonstrating stable convergence without prior information.
    • Successful reconstruction of complex laser pulses was achieved.
    • The approach shows high performance even with significant noise and incomplete FROG traces.

    Conclusions:

    • The proposed multi-grid flexible sampling and parallel ePIE method offers a robust solution for FROG pulse reconstruction.
    • This technique significantly improves convergence stability and accuracy, particularly for challenging datasets.
    • The findings pave the way for more reliable characterization of ultrafast optical pulses.
